Undertones

When choosing a neutral brown hair color, it's essential to consider its undertones. Undertones refer to the subtle hues that underlie the hair color, influencing its overall appearance and how it complements different skin tones.

  • Warm Undertones

    Warm undertones have golden, red, or orange hues. They complement skin tones with yellow or golden undertones, creating a harmonious and radiant look.

  • Cool Undertones

    Cool undertones have blue, violet, or ash hues. They suit skin tones with pink or red undertones, neutralizing any redness and creating a sophisticated and icy effect.

  • Neutral Undertones

    Neutral undertones have a balance of both warm and cool hues. They are versatile and flattering for a wide range of skin tones, creating a natural and understated look.

Understanding undertones is crucial for achieving a neutral brown hair color that enhances your natural features. By carefully selecting a shade that complements your skin's undertones, you can create a cohesive and flattering look that will turn heads.

Maintenance

Maintenance plays a crucial role in preserving the vibrancy and longevity of neutral brown hair color. Chemical treatments like hair coloring can alter the hair's structure, making it more susceptible to damage and fading over time. Regular touch-ups every 4-6 weeks are recommended to refresh the color and prevent brassiness or. Additionally, using color-safe shampoos and conditioners specifically designed for colored hair helps maintain vibrancy and minimize color loss.

Deep conditioning treatments and regular trims are also essential maintenance practices to keep neutral brown hair healthy and radiant. Deep conditioning treatments replenish moisture and nutrients, preventing dryness and breakage. Regular trims remove split ends, which can cause hair to look dull and unkempt. By following these maintenance practices, individuals can prolong the longevity of their neutral brown hair color and keep it looking its best.

Trends

Trends play a significant role in the evolution of neutral brown hair color, as they influence the perception, popularity, and styling of this versatile shade. Fashion trends, celebrity endorsements, and sociocultural shifts can all contribute to the emergence and adoption of specific neutral brown hair color trends.

Understanding the connection between trends and neutral brown hair color is crucial for hair stylists and individuals seeking to stay abreast of the latest styles. By identifying and analyzing current trends, hair professionals can tailor their recommendations and techniques to meet the evolving demands of their clients. Individuals can also make informed decisions about their hair color choices, ensuring their style aligns with their personal preferences and the broader fashion landscape.

Real-life examples of trends within neutral brown hair color include the recent popularity of "mushroom brown," a cool-toned shade with ash and beige undertones, and "bronde," a blend of brown and blonde that creates a sun-kissed effect. These trends have gained traction due to their versatility, flattering nature, and ability to complement a wide range of skin tones.

Tips for Neutral Brown Hair Color

Unlock the full potential of your neutral brown hair color with these expert tips. From enhancing shine to adding depth and dimension, these practical techniques will elevate your hair game and keep your locks looking their best.

Tip 1: Embrace Glossing Treatments
Glossing adds a layer of shine and vibrancy to neutral brown hair color, creating a polished and healthy appearance.

Tip 2: Add Subtle Highlights or Lowlights
Strategic placement of highlights or lowlights can add depth and dimension to neutral brown hair, creating a more dynamic and visually interesting look.

Tip 3: Use Color-Enhancing Shampoos and Conditioners
Incorporate color-enhancing hair care products into your routine to maintain the vibrancy and prevent fading of your neutral brown hair color.

Tip 4: Protect from Heat Damage
Excessive heat styling can damage and dull hair color. Use heat protectant sprays and limit the use of hot tools to maintain the integrity of your neutral brown hair.

Tip 5: Deep Condition Regularly
Deep conditioning treatments nourish and moisturize hair, restoring its health and vibrancy. Regular deep conditioning will keep your neutral brown hair color looking radiant and feeling soft.

Tip 6: Avoid Over-Washing
Excessive washing can strip away natural oils, leading to dryness and dullness. Adjust your washing frequency to maintain the optimal balance for your hair type and neutral brown hair color.

Tip 7: Get Regular Trims
Regular trims remove split ends and prevent breakage, keeping your neutral brown hair healthy and its color vibrant. Healthy hair reflects light better, enhancing its overall appearance.

Tip 8: Experiment with Different Styling Products
Explore various styling products to enhance the texture and movement of your neutral brown hair. From volumizing mousses to smoothing serums, find products that complement your hair type and desired style.
